SUMMARY
The Digital Display & IPTV Technician shall provide onsite management, support, and upkeep of the digital display and IPTV systems at Gillette Stadium and Patriot Place. The primary responsibility of this role is to lead in the design, configuration, installation and maintenance of all digital display and IPTV systems throughout the Foxborough Campus. This role will support event operations including NFL and MLS games, major concert tours, corporate events, and specialty activations to deliver best in class service.
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Lead or assist in the design, configuration, installation, operation, repair, and maintenance of all digital display and IPTV systems through the direction of the Broadcast Systems Engineer.
- Develop and assist in creating system configuration documentation, standard operating procedures (SOPs) to contribute with the improvement of system guidelines and policies.
- Assist in project scheduling and deployment of new system rollout or maintenance to ensure full functionality and security compliance of hardware and software for all digital display and IPTV systems.
- Provide game day or event support staff with services associated with content management, component troubleshooting, software troubleshooting, training, live video ingest, proof of play reporting, and more for all events in Gillette Stadium and Patriot Place
- Supervise, train, and develop PT staff in the operation, troubleshooting, repair, and maintenance of all digital display and IPTV system hardware and software.
- Work with Gillette Stadium Special Events staff to ensure all meeting and event spaces and their respective digital display and LED systems are operational.
- Support the Audio Visual and Broadcast Systems Department projects through all stages of the construction process from RFP, design review, installation, integration, testing, commissioning, and training.
- Provide extensive troubleshooting, installation, configuration, and testing of all digital display and IPTV systems to include but not limited to LED content playback and processor systems, monitors, digital media players, fiber converters, projection systems, digital signage displays, LED displays, RF cable systems, streaming and encoding technologies, and more.
- Identify and report issues with all digital display and IPTV systems and provide step by step actions to take to resolve the issues.
- Ability to interface with cross-functional teams in the delivery of services to include collaboration with IT, Stadium Operations, Facilities, outside vendors, and more.
- Special projects and assignments as business dictates
